NFL Playoff Picture 2025-26 Bracket Clinching and Elimination Scenarios for Week 14

Adam WellsDec 2, 2025

The NFL always prides itself on parity, but this year is taking things to another level in that regard with just five weeks remaining in the 2025 regular season.

Heading into Week 14, six of the eight divisions have at least two teams within one game in the loss column of first place. Three divisions have two teams tied for first place.

The wild-card picture in both conferences is just as chaotic. All three AFC wild-card teams currently have an 8-4 record. The lowest-seeded team in the NFC playoffs right now are the San Francisco 49ers, who have as many wins as the No. 1 seed.

That No. 1 seed, by the way, is the Chicago Bears after a stunning Black Friday win over the reeling Philadelphia Eagles. They own the NFC's longest active winning streak at five games.

Here are the updated playoff scenarios after a chaotic week and going into Week 14.

Playoff Clinching Scenarios

The earliest potential clinching scenario won't be until Week 15, which NFL consultant Joe Ferreira noted will mark the latest that the first teams can secure a postseason berth since the league added a bye week to the schedule in 1990.

Looking ahead to Week 15, the New England Patriots can clinch the AFC East with a win over the Buffalo Bills.

Playoff Elimination Scenarios

Minnesota Vikings Elimination Scenarios

  • Vikings loss vs. Washington Commanders
  • or Vikings tie vs. Washington Commanders AND Green Bay Packers win/tie vs. Chicago Bears

One year after finishing tied with the Philadelphia Eagles for the second-most wins in the NFL during the regular season, the Vikings' playoff hopes could end in the first week of December with a loss to the Washington Commanders.

There is also a scenario at play in which the Vikings-Commanders game ends in a tie and Minnesota is eliminated, but the simplest scenario for the team to keep hope alive for another week would be to win on Sunday.

Washington Commanders Elimination Scenarios

  • Commanders loss/tie at Minnesota Vikings
  • or Philadelphia Eagles win/tie at Los Angeles Chargers

The 2025 season for the Commanders has been a huge disappointment, with injuries to key players largely at the center of their struggles.

After reaching the NFC Championship Game last season, the Commanders could be eliminated from playoff contention as soon as Sunday against the Minnesota Vikings. Even if they manage to win that game, the Philadelphia Eagles not losing on Monday Night Football against the Los Angeles Chargers will knock them out.

Atlanta Falcons Elimination Scenarios

  • Falcons loss vs. Seattle Seahawks
  • or Falcons tie vs. Seattle Seahawks AND Tampa Bay Buccaneers win/tie vs. New Orleans Saints AND Green Bay Packers win/tie vs. Chicago Bears

There are few teams that have had a more bleak 2025 than the Falcons. Michael Penix Jr. has only made 12 starts through his first two seasons and will spend the offseason rehabbing from another major knee injury.

The Falcons could be eliminated from playoff contention as soon as Week 14, and they don't even have a first-round pick in the 2026 draft to look forward to. They will send their pick, currently No. 9 overall, to the Los Angeles Rams.

New York Jets Elimination Scenarios

  • Jets loss/tie vs. Miami Dolphins
  • or Houston Texans win at Kansas City Chiefs AND Buffalo Bills win/tie vs. Cincinnati Bengals
  • or Houston Texans win at Kansas City Chiefs AND Indianapolis Colts-Jacksonville Jaguars ends in a tie
  • or Buffalo Bills win/tie vs. Cincinnati Bengals AND Jacksonville Jaguars win/tie vs. Indianapolis Colts

The Jets have been playing respectable with three wins in their last five games after starting the season 0-7, but their playoff drought could officially extend to 15 years as soon as Sunday afternoon.

Cleveland Browns Elimination Scenarios

  • Browns loss vs. Tennessee Titans

Week 14 at least presents a scenario in which the Browns could be favored going into a December game against a Tennessee Titans team that currently owns the NFL's worst record (1-11).

A loss would eliminate Cleveland from playoff contention for the second consecutive year and 24th time in 27 seasons since the franchise returned to the NFL in 1999.
